Aderemi Raji-Oyelade, a professor in the Department
of English, University of Ibadan, has been announced as a
winner of the Humboldt Alumni Award 2017 for Innovative
Networking Initiatives. The
Alexander von Humboldt Foundation grants up to four Humboldt
Alumni Awards per year to promote innovative networking
initiatives of alumni of the Alexander von Humboldt
Foundation's fellowship and award programmes. It is
designed to support initiatives not covered by the
Foundation's existing sponsorship and alumni programmes,
and to promote academic and cultural relations between
Germany and the Humboldt Alumni's own countries and
strengthen their collaboration in the respective
regions. In a
statement by Dr.
Enno Aufderheide, the
General Secretary of the Foundation, "This award shall give you the opportunity
to implement your proposed networking initiative as well as
contribute to support sustainable academic and cultural
relations between Germany and your home country, and to
strengthen the regional alumni network. I would like to
offer my congratulations on this exceptional
achievement." Raji-Oyelade's award-winning project is entitled
"Postproverbial Africa: Building a Corpora of Wits in
Texts, Media and Performance", a trans-national initiative
which brings African scholars in the humanities together
with the ultimate aim of contributing to the body of modern
and radical proverbs which are created mainly in urban
communities almost all over the African
continent. The
Humboldt Alumni Award ceremony will take place in June 2017
during the Alexander von Humboldt Foundation's Annual
Meeting in Berlin. Funding for the award is being provided
by the German Foreign Office.
